lotus domino 自动定时压缩数据库1
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
Lotus Domino 是一款强大的协作和应用开发平台,其数据库管理功能是系统的核心组成部分。自动定时压缩数据库是一项重要的维护任务,可以有效地优化数据库性能,减少存储空间占用,提高系统的整体效率。下面将详细介绍如何在 Lotus Domino 中设置自动定时压缩数据库。 理解数据库压缩的原理。在 Lotus Domino 中,数据库压缩会删除不再使用的记录,合并数据库的片段,并释放被已删除文档占用的空间。这有助于减小数据库文件的大小,同时保持数据的完整性和可用性。 在 Lotus Domino 中实现自动定时压缩,需要通过服务器的控制台命令来执行。控制台命令是直接在操作系统层面运行的,通常以 `nserver -c` 开头,后面的参数则是具体的Domino命令。在这个案例中,我们需要运行的命令是 `compact -B`,其中 `-B` 参数表示后台压缩,这样不会影响到用户对数据库的正常使用。 以下是设置自动定时压缩的步骤: 1. **打开公共通讯录文件**:登录到 Lotus Domino 服务器,找到并打开服务器的公共通讯录文件(names.nsf)。 2. **添加程序**:在公共通讯录的“服务器”文档中,找到“程序”部分,然后点击“添加程序”按钮,准备创建一个新的服务器任务。 3. **配置命令**:在“基本”选项卡中,输入程序的具体信息。在“程序名”字段中,输入 `load compact -B`,这里的 `load` 命令用于加载并执行Domino服务器上的内置任务或程序,`-B` 参数指定了后台运行压缩操作。在“参数”字段中,指定要压缩的数据库名,例如 `mail` 表示压缩所有邮件数据库。 4. **设置时间计划**:在“日程安排”选项卡中,根据实际需求设定压缩任务的执行时间。你可以选择每天、每周、每月或者自定义特定时间进行执行,确保在服务器负载较低时进行,以避免影响正常服务。 对于Unix系统,程序名应直接填写 `compact -B`,因为系统会直接识别这个命令。在“日程安排”中,添加相应的调度规则,例如 `0 0 * * *` 代表每天凌晨0点执行。 完成以上步骤后,保存并启动此程序,Lotus Domino 就会在指定的时间自动执行数据库压缩。需要注意的是,压缩过程可能会消耗一定资源,因此最好在系统低峰时段执行,以免影响其他服务的性能。 此外,定期监控和调整压缩计划也是必要的,因为随着数据库的增长和使用情况的变化,可能需要调整压缩频率或时间。同时,定期检查服务器日志,确认压缩任务是否成功执行,及时处理可能出现的错误或警告。 自动定时压缩数据库是 Lotus Domino 管理的重要一环,它有助于保持数据库的高效运行,节省存储空间,同时也减轻了管理员的维护负担。正确设置和监控这个功能,能够显著提升 Lotus Domino 系统的整体性能和稳定性。
- 粉丝: 892
- 资源: 730
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助